Asus VivoBook Pro 15 N580 Series — 11.49V Li-Polymer Replacement Battery (C31N1636)

This 11.49V, 4050mAh Li-Polymer battery replaces the OEM C31N1636 cell in the Asus VivoBook Pro 15 and N580 series laptops. It fits the N580GD, N580GD-DM230T, and over 40 additional N580 variants sharing the same connector and BMS handshake. Capacity and chemistry match the original specification exactly.

  • N580 platform compatibility: All covered models share the same 11.49V three-cell architecture, physical connector pinout, and BMS communication protocol. The BIOS on these boards reads cell data over SMBus — the replacement cell responds to that handshake correctly without firmware modification.
  • Bench tested on actual hardware: We cycled this cell on an N580GD board, confirmed charge acceptance from 0% to 100% without cutoff, and verified the BMS reported cell voltage within normal range across all three cells throughout the charge curve.
  • Post-install calibration on the N580: After fitting, run the laptop on battery only until it hibernates at critical charge, then charge uninterrupted to 100%. This forces the BIOS battery learn cycle to reset against the new cell's actual capacity and clears the inaccurate health warning that appears after every cell swap.

Why the VivoBook Pro 15 BIOS reports poor battery health after a cell swap

The N580 BIOS stores learned capacity data from the previous cell in a persistent register. When a new cell is installed, that stored data does not match the fresh cell's actual charge curve, so the BIOS flags health as degraded immediately. This is not a fault with the replacement cell. Running one full discharge-to-hibernate followed by an uninterrupted charge to 100% resets the learn cycle and clears the warning. After two to three full cycles, the fuel gauge IC recalibrates and the health status normalises.

VivoBook Pro 15 shutting down at 20–30% shown on the gauge

This happens when the fuel gauge IC is still using capacity data mapped to the old, degraded cell. As the battery discharges under combined CPU and display load, the actual cell voltage drops faster than the stale gauge model predicts — the system hits its low-voltage cutoff while the OS still shows charge remaining. It is not a fault in the new cell. Run two full discharge-to-hibernate cycles, charging to 100% each time, to force the fuel gauge IC to remap against the new cell's actual voltage curve. After recalibration, the gauge and the physical cutoff point will align and shutdowns at 20–30% will stop.

Frequently Asked Questions

The VivoBook Pro 15 is showing the new battery as "0% available (plugged in, charging)" and won't move off zero — what's happening?

The EEPROM data from the old cell is still resident in the fuel gauge IC, and the controller is treating the new cell as unknown until it completes a full charge cycle. Leave the laptop plugged in and charging without interrupting it — do not restart or put it to sleep. Once it reaches 100% and you run one full discharge to hibernate, the IC will register the new cell correctly and the 0% reading will clear.

Windows is reporting the new C31N1636 battery as 46Wh in Settings but the BIOS health screen shows a different Wh figure — which is right?

The BIOS pulls its Wh figure from a static value written to the cell's EEPROM at manufacture, while Windows calculates Wh dynamically from measured voltage and current draw. These two figures come from different sources and a mismatch after a cell swap is normal. The Windows-reported value becomes accurate after two full calibration cycles. The EEPROM figure in the BIOS is reference data only and does not affect charging behaviour or capacity.

The VivoBook Pro 15 battery stopped charging at 80% and won't go higher — is the replacement cell faulty?

This is almost always the BIOS charge limit feature, not the cell. Asus laptops include a battery care setting in MyASUS and in the BIOS that caps charging at 80% to reduce calendar ageing during periods of mostly plugged-in use. Open MyASUS, go to Customization → Battery Health Charging, and switch from Balanced Mode to Full Capacity Mode. The battery will then charge to 100%.
